SciQuest is used here at University Hospital in Newark, NJ for ALL purchases that go to outside vendors. In addition, we also use the supplies manager module for our in-house warehouse, which is used to bring consumable supplies to the various nursing stations throughout the hospital, and also to the OR. We also store our contracts within the system, and use the Spend Director module to keep track of our spend against our various contracts. All of our approvals, at the department, budget and purchasing levels, are done within SciQuest. It addresses the whole procure-to-pay cycle in an exemplary manner. We are in the process of renewing our deal with them.
- Supplier relationships, in terms of setting up supplier catalogs and keeping them up-to-date, are handled by SciQuest in an exemplary fashion.
- The approval process, using Advanced Dynamic Workflow (ADW), is extremely powerful and allows you to create approval workflows which will exactly match your needs.
- The Compliance Tracker module, part of Spend Director, is a great tool for capturing spend under contract. It is also a very good tool for storing contract information and documents, and tracking and disseminating through email notifications information such as expiration date and contract budgets.
- SciQuest customer service is, overall, excellent. We have always had a good working relationship with the company and feel as though they listen to us as we voice our needs and wants.
- Unable to directly access SciQuest data through a report writing tool such as Crystal Reports or MS Access, so we have to build a shadow database if we want to run any ad-hoc reports (reports that are not part of the "canned" SciQuest package). This is, by far, my biggest gripe with the SciQuest product.
- Would be nice for users (especially very knowledgeable users) to be able to upload a worksheet into the system and create a requisition from it. Our users who order for the OR frequently get a spreadsheet with a long list of items. They then have to manually enter those items, one by one, into the system.
- The Supplies Manager module is fairly rudimentary.

We use it to Shop for products, make service purchases through forms, implement a workflow for approvals based on amount of purchase, use it to create requisitions, purchase orders and vouchers that feed into the PeopleSoft ERP. Makes sure that all purchases have checks and balances and approvals in place for all orders. It is used across 80% of the organization. Our Athletics Department does not use it yet. We are able to run reports on cycle time regarding how long it takes for a cart/requisition to become a purchase order and to be paid. We can load our state contracts into the system.
- The document search and filters are an amazing tool. You can basically search/query the system on all types of documents and then can export out that data with a screen export, transaction export of full export which allows you to basically report on anything you find important.
- It is user friendly and adopts new web practices being used on other shopping sites such as the cart preview and adding bookmarks.
- There is a lot of documentation for you to find out how to do certain things in the system.
- There are a lot of "clicks" involved with selecting things. For example, you have to press the Search button and "Select" the fields etc. You cannot press enter etc.
- The forms are pretty constrictive as far as design. You cannot do a lot of customizing on the forms.
- Limited to changing look and feel to very small areas
